The Comet (Al-Taareq)
17 verses, revealed in Mecca after The Town (Al-Balad) before The Moon (Al-Qamar)
In the Name of God, the Merciful, the Compassionate
By the heaven and the night-comer 1 what do you know what the night-visitor is? 2 It is the star that shines with a piercing brightness -- 3 [for] no human being has been left unguarded. 4 Let man consider what he was made of: 5 he has been created out of a seminal fluid 6 issuing from between the loins [of man] and the pelvic arch [of woman]. 7 God has certainly power to bring him back (from the dead). 8 upon the day when the secrets are tried, 9 (Man) will have no power, and no helper. 10 Consider the heavens, ever-revolving, 11 And the earth which splitteth (with the growth of trees and plants) 12 Indeed the Qur’an is a decisive Word. 13 and is not to be taken lightly. 14 Surely they will make a scheme, 15 And I (too) will make a scheme. 16 So respite the unbelievers; delay with them awhile. 17
Allah Almighty has spoken the truth.
End of Surah: The Comet (Al-Taareq). Sent down in Mecca after The Town (Al-Balad) before The Moon (Al-Qamar)
